Stratview Research has published a new report titled “Industrial Power Transmission Market” which is segmented by Transmission Type (Belt and Chain), by Application Type (General Industries, Energy & Others, Construction Materials, Food & Beverage, Warehouse & Distribution, Lumber & Aggregates, and Agriculture), by End-User Type (OE and Aftermarket), and by Region (North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and Rest of the World).

As per the study, Industrial power transmission means the transfer of energy so that it can be transmitted to the desired application with the appropriate power, speed, and torque. Due to the increasing modernization of existing infrastructure all over the world, the industrial power transmission market is expected to grow significantly. Moreover, considerable R&D investments are pushing the global use of technologically advanced equipment.

Due to increased awareness regarding the reduction of energy loss, manufacturers are focussing on cost-effective and energy-efficient equipment. A favorable business environment has also been created by increased manufacturing operations, especially in developing economies. In 2020, With the abrupt breakout of the COVID-19 pandemic, the market for industrial power transmission suffered a considerable fall of -7.2%. Companies have suffered significant losses as a result of the entire lockdown paired with a labor shortage and temporary shutdown of manufacturing plants.

The market is predicted to progressively improve in the coming years, primarily due to rising consumer acceptance. Product demand will be boosted even more by rising investments for technological advancements. Furthermore, favorable regulatory changes and supporting industrial reforms will drive market growth. Overall, in the long run, the industrial power transmission market is expected to grow at a respectable CAGR of 3.4% to be reaching a value of US$ 11.0 billion in 2026.

Based on the transmission type, the industrial power transmission market is segmented as belt and chain. Chain is expected to remain the larger transmission type in the market during the forecast period. The wide usage of transmission chains in the chemical, agriculture, oil & gas, pharmaceutical, mining, and construction industries is one of the primary drivers of market expansion. Material handling, manufacturing, and agricultural & food processing equipment are just a few of the applications for industrial roller chains. Roller chains provide machine-driven power to a variety of industrial machinery. It is observed that the industrial belts are replacing industrial chains in some applications, owing to certain advantages of belts over chains, such as no requirement of frequent lubrication and reduced noise.

Based on the application type, the market is segmented as general industries, energy & others, construction materials, food & beverage, warehouse & distribution, lumber & aggregates, and agriculture. Warehouse & distribution is expected to be the fastest-growing application type in the market during the forecast period. The warehousing & distribution business is anticipated to grow significantly due to the development of new technologies, increasing imports & exports, and the rapidly expanding e-commerce industry. A boom in commercial activity in rising economies, such as China, India, Indonesia, Russia, and Brazil, is further substantiating the warehousing & storage business.

Based on the end-user type, the market is segmented as OE and aftermarket. Aftermarket is expected to be the dominant segment of the market during the forecast period. Old chains and belts must be replaced to smooth operations as well as to save manpower, energy, and cost. Manufacturers are switching to new and technologically advanced products.

Which Region is expected to remain the largest market?

In terms of regions, Asia-Pacific is expected to remain the largest as well as the fastest-growing market for industrial power transmission during the forecast period. The market of industrial power transmission will grow significantly due to rapid industrialization in developing nations like China, India, and other South-East Asian countries. Rising energy consumption in emerging economies as well as rising investments to incorporate sustainable and efficient infrastructure are the key factors responsible for the market growth.
